How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ction Studio Apartments | $1,301 | $750 | $1,675 |
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,510 | $918 | $2,616 |
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,850 | $1,090 | $3,588 |
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,269 | $1,300 | $4,500 |
Rt 60 Corr to Apache Junction 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,416 | $1,600 | $2,995 |
